Bangalore: Loopt, a location based application service announced at the Where 2.0, conference, a new feature called Loopt Qs. The feature allows users to answer questions and see other user's responses in any physical business location. Loopt Qs enables users to search and visit locations, check-in, and connect with others in a network. It also allows users to create questions. Loopt team will create polls where users can share their answers with Loopt users and with friends on Facebook and Twitter to get more answer to a question and to share a specific answer. By clicking on the Qs button on the Loopt app's homescreen user can see many questions and can contribute answers to them. The Qs are designed to give the user a quick view of information that helps them to save their time. Loopt takes a collection of answers from many users and presents them in a graph. Yelp provides online local search capabilities for its visitors. Loopt is planning to release the new feature in San Francisco first and then will follow the other cities. The app is currently available on iPhone, iPod Touch and Android.
